Home About Us Contact Us

Join our mailing list


Events Calendar

Click Here for link to calendar to see upcoming ECOSF events

ECOSF Contact Us

Please feel free to contact us with any questions, concerns, comments, suggestions, opinions or anything else you would like to share.


We truly appreciate and depend on the ideas and feedback from everyone to help cooperatively create community.

Email: info(at)eco-sf.org    Phone: (415) 565-9576

Mailing Address:
424 Russia Ave.
San Francisco, CA 94112

Farm Address:
555 Portola Dr.
San Francisco ,CA 94131